Practical Oncology Journal ; (6): 103-106, 2018.
Article in Chinese | WPRIM | ID: wpr-697912

ABSTRACT

Objective The objective of this study was to investigate the effect of Wnt pathway inhibitor-ETC-159 on pro-liferation and migration of oral squamous cell carcinoma(SCC-15)cells and to explore its mechanism.Methods SCC-15 cells were treated with DMSO and ETC-159 for 12 h or 24 h.Cell proliferation was detected by CCK8 kit.Transwell assay was used to de-tect the ability of cell migration.Western blotting was used to detect cell migration related to proteins i.e.Wnt3a and β-catenin,pro-liferation and migration related proteins i.e.c-Myc,cyclin D1,CD146.Results After treated with ETC-159 for 12 or 24 h,the proliferation,migration and expression of Wnt3a,β-catenin,c-Myc,cyclin D1 and CD146 in SCC-15 cells were significantly de-creased when compared to the DMSO group(P<0.05).Conclusion Wnt signaling pathway inhibitor-ETC-159 can inhibit the proliferation and migration of SCC-15 cells by decreased levels of c-Myc,cyclin D1 and CD146.

Herald of Medicine ; (12): 741-745, 2017.
Article in Chinese | WPRIM | ID: wpr-620261

ABSTRACT

Objective To observe the effect of Puerarin on the level of tau phosphorylation in the olfactory bulb of Alzheimer's disease rat brain, and explore the underlying molecular mechanism.Methods ① Twenty-two male SD rats were randomly divided into the normal control group, model control group and Puerain-treated group.The levels of tau-1, PS396 and tau-5 in the olfactory bulb were detected by Western blotting.② Twenty male SD rats were randomly divided into model control group, low-dose Puerarin (40 mg·kg-1·d-1), medium-dose puerarin (80 mg·kg-1·d-1) and high-dose puerarin (160 mg·kg-1·d-1) groups.The levels of tau-1 and PS396 phosphorylation in the olfactory bulb were detected by Western blotting.③ The level of GSK-3β phosphorylation in the olfactory bulb of the normal control group, model control group A and puerain-treated group was detected by Western blotting.Results ① It was shown by Western blotting that the relative expression of tau-1 was significantly decreased in the olfactory bulb of the model group A(0.49±0.07)rat brain compared with the normal control group(0.85±0.03)(P<0.01), and the level of tau-1 was obviously higher in the puerarin-treated group(0.58±0.03)compared with that of the model group A(P<0.05).The differences of the levels of tau-5 and PS396 in the olfactory bulb were insignificant among the 3 groups.②Compared with the model group B, the expression of tau-1 in the olfactory bulb was significantly enhanced in the low-, medium-and high-dose of puerarin group: (0.39±0.09)vs(0.69±0.11),(0.55±0.11),(0.70±0.04);and the level of PS396 was significantly decreased in the olfactory bulb of low-dose puerarin group(0.36±0.07) compared with the model group B(0.55±0.05)(P<0.01).③Compared with the normal control group(0.96±0.07), the ratio of pS9-GSK-3β/tGSK-3β was obviously decreased in the olfactory bulb of the model group A(0.51±0.12),while that was significantly increased in the puerarin group(0.62±0.03) compared with the model group A(P<0.01).Conclusion Puerarin can attenuate AD-like tau hyperphosphorylation in the olfactory bulb of Alzheimer's disease rat brains, and decreased activity of GSK-3β might be involved in the effects of puerarin on tau hyperphosphorylation.
